Before You Begin: Safety First!
Before we even think about touching any tools or machinery, safety is paramount. Always ensure your edge banding machine is completely disconnected from the power supply. Wear appropriate safety gear, including safety glasses, gloves, and hearing protection. Familiarize yourself with your machine’s operating manual and safety precautions. This will prevent accidents and ensure a smooth installation process.
Step 1: Preparation is Key
Before you begin the installation, carefully inspect the pneumatic trimmer and all its components. Check for any damage during shipping. Make sure you have all the necessary tools and parts listed in your trimmer's manual. This usually includes Allen wrenches, screwdrivers, and possibly a few specialized tools specific to your model. Having everything ready will streamline the installation and avoid frustrating delays.
You should also prepare your edge banding machine. Clean the area where the trimmer will be installed, ensuring it’s free from dust, debris, or any obstacles that could interfere with the installation or operation. This meticulous preparation will ensure a smooth and accurate installation.
Step 2: Mounting the Pneumatic Trimmer
This step varies slightly depending on the specific model of your edge banding machine and pneumatic trimmer. However, the general principle remains the same. Refer to your trimmer's installation manual for precise instructions. Typically, you’ll need to secure the trimmer to the machine using provided bolts and brackets. Ensure the trimmer is mounted securely and correctly aligned. A misaligned trimmer can lead to uneven trimming and damage to your edge banding. Tighten all bolts securely, but avoid over-tightening, which could damage the components.
Step 3: Connecting the Air Supply
This is a critical step. Connect the pneumatic trimmer to your compressed air supply using an appropriate air hose and fittings. Ensure all connections are secure and leak-free. A leaking connection will not only reduce the trimmer's performance but can also create a safety hazard. After connecting the air supply, check for any leaks by carefully inspecting all the joints. Use soapy water to detect any leaks – bubbles will indicate a leak that needs to be addressed.
Step 4: Adjusting the Trimmer Blade
The trimmer blade needs to be precisely adjusted for optimal performance. This is often done using adjustment screws on the trimmer. The manual will provide specific instructions for adjusting the blade's height and position. Incorrect adjustment will lead to poor trimming quality, leaving uneven edges or even damaging the banding. Start with a minimal adjustment and then test the trimmer with some scrap material. Gradually adjust the blade until you achieve a clean and precise cut.
Step 5: Testing and Fine-Tuning
After completing the installation, it’s crucial to thoroughly test the trimmer. Use scrap material to test the trimmer's performance, paying close attention to the quality of the cut. Make any necessary adjustments to the blade height and position until you achieve the desired results. During testing, monitor the air pressure and ensure it’s within the recommended range specified in your machine's manual. If the trimmer is not working correctly, carefully review each step of the installation process and refer to the troubleshooting section of the manual.
Troubleshooting Common Issues
Even with careful installation, you might encounter some problems. Here are some common issues and their possible solutions:
Uneven Trimming: This could be due to a misaligned trimmer, a dull blade, or incorrect blade adjustment. Check the alignment, replace the blade if necessary, and readjust the blade position.
Trimming Blade Jams: This could be caused by debris in the trimmer or improper blade adjustment. Clean the trimmer thoroughly and check the blade adjustment.
Air Leaks: Check all air connections for leaks and tighten any loose fittings. Replace damaged air hoses if necessary.
Noisy Operation: This could be due to loose parts or a worn-out bearing. Check for loose parts and replace any worn-out components.
Maintenance and Care
Regular maintenance is essential for the longevity and performance of your pneumatic trimmer. Clean the trimmer regularly, removing any dust or debris. Lubricate moving parts as recommended in the manual. Inspect the blade regularly and replace it when it becomes dull or damaged. Regular maintenance will not only prolong the lifespan of your trimmer but also ensure consistent performance and quality trimming.
